Ericson Statistics Back to top
- Population (2000): 253
- Land Area (2000): 94.035 square kilometers
- Water Area (2000): 0.074 square kilometers
Houses (2000): 98

Ericson Top Specified Ancestries
| Rank | Ancestry | Percent Of Specified Ancestries | |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1. | German | 112 | 37.84% |
| 2. | Norwegian | 79 | 26.69% |
| 3. | Dutch | 34 | 11.49% |
| 4. | Swedish | 27 | 9.12% |
| 5. | Danish | 7 | 2.36% |
| 6. | Scotch Irish | 6 | 2.03% |
| 7. | Scandinavian | 5 | 1.69% |
| 8. | Czech | 4 | 1.35% |
| 9. | European | 4 | 1.35% |
| 10. | Irish | 4 | 1.35% |
Ericson Top Languages Spoken At Home
| Rank | Language | Percent Of Reported Languages | |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1. | Only English | 232 | 96.67% |
| 2. | German | 6 | 2.50% |
| 3. | Portuguese / Portuguese Creole | 2 | 0.83% |
